valora-inc / wallet

The official repository for the Valora mobile cryptocurrency wallet.
https://valora.xyz
Apache License 2.0
170 stars 80 forks source link

App get crashed when user try to scan QR code shown “https://use-contractkit.vercel.app” website #1186

Closed ValoraQA closed 2 years ago

ValoraQA commented 2 years ago

Frequency: 100% Repro on build version: Android Internal build V1.20.0 Does Not Repro on build version: Test Flight Build V1.20.0 , Android Internal build V1.19.0, Test Flight Build V1.19.0 Repro on devices: Redmi Note 8 (10.0),Redmi Note 8 (9.0), OnePlus 7t (11.0) Does Not Repro on devices: iPhone 12 (14.7.1), iPhone 6+ (12.5.4), iPhone SE (13.6.1)

Testing Account: (680) 333 1978 /Account Key Pre-condition: Make sure that user should have logged into application

Repro Steps:

  1. Launch the “https://use-contractkit.vercel.app” website
  2. Select Valora from Wallet Connect popup by tapping on Connect button from Mainnet version
  3. Now user should on QR code page
  4. Now go to Connected Apps option from settings of Valora application
  5. Try to scan QR code shown & observed that

Current Behavior: App get crashed & user thrown out of an application redirects to mobile Home screen

Expected Behavior: QR code should be scanned & user should able to see account details on web

Impact: Bad user experience as the Android user gets blocked to perform WC action successfully.

Attachment: CrashWhileScanningQRCodeForWC.mp4 Crash_Logs

ValoraQA commented 2 years ago

Hey @gnardini, We have observed that on navigating to this link: https://use-contractkit.vercel.app/, "404:Not Found" error appears, So we are not able to verify this issue. NOTE: We are able to connect wallet by scanning the QR codes using Sushi Swap & Pool together. Devices: Redmi Note 8 (10.0), iPhone 6+(12.5.4), iPhone 12 (14.7.1) Browser: Microsoft Edge V93.0, Safari V14.7.1, Safari V12.5.4 Attachment: Error use-contractkit.jpg

MuckT commented 2 years ago

@ValoraQA try https://use-contractkit-c-labs.vercel.app/ instead of https://use-contractkit.vercel.app/